Output 752a39a4f8bdbece7d4cdb151cdd3f5c2689f7bc5f77830490fb8c4a0f4bf729:40

value
644682
script pubkey
OP_0 OP_PUSHBYTES_20 e4a12df55ff15676b78dbf73df55aaf5c26e249b
address
bc1qujsjma2l79t8ddudhaea74d27hpxufymtrq5sd
transaction
752a39a4f8bdbece7d4cdb151cdd3f5c2689f7bc5f77830490fb8c4a0f4bf729
spent
true